US Appeals Court Allows TikTok to Face Potential Ban Unless ByteDance Divests
A US appeals court has denied TikTok’s emergency bid to block a law requiring its parent company, ByteDance, to divest the app by January 19 or face a ban. TikTok, which boasts over 170 million users in the US, is now urged to appeal to the Supreme Court. The law raises concerns over foreign ownership and national security, with the Justice Department arguing that continued Chinese control poses a threat. TikTok counters that its operations in the US mitigate these risks.
